Criminal trial – defeat for Credit Suisse – economy

Credit Suisse has lost the first Swiss criminal case against a major bank. The Swiss Federal Criminal Court found the institute guilty of money laundering on Monday. The judges had to decide whether the bank and a former employee had done enough to prevent money laundering by an alleged Bulgarian cocaine trafficking gang in 2004-2008. The former customer advisor was also convicted. Both had denied wrongdoing. The trial, in which witness statements about murders were made, among other things, is considered a test case for tougher action by the judiciary against the country’s banks.
